Weekly Knox: Together with Mary

In discussing how one could get discouraged on retreat, Knox encourages his readers to stay "together with Mary"  and to "try and put yourself in the position of those first apostles, who now and again, perhaps, in the course of their ungrateful novena (between Ascension and Pentecost), would steal a look at her motionless figure and wonder what thoughts were passing through her mind.  Keep her close in view; the spring of her perpetual virginity will rejuvenate us." - A Retreat for Lay People
